Mood Boost
We’ve all felt that moment of ecstasy while enjoying a piece of melt-in-your-mouth
chocolate. Turns out this happy feeling isn’t just
in our heads! That’s because chocolate contains two ‘feel-good’ chemicals, phenylethylamine
and serotonin that may help elevate your mood. One Swiss study even found that consuming a small daily dose of (dark) chocolate lowered stress hormones in people with high anxiety levels. Bet I just put a smile on your face. ;)
JOY’S DARK CHOCOLATE FONDUE In a medium saucepan, whisk 1 tbsp cornstarch into 1 (12 oz)
can evaporated milk. Place over low heat and stir in ½ cup unsweetened cocoa powder, ½ cup sugar, ½ tsp vanilla extract, and 1
/8 tsp Kosher salt. Cook, whisking constantly, until
thoroughly combined and the liquid starts to thicken, about 10 minutes. Serve immediately with strawberries and pineapple (or other fresh fruit, such as sliced apples, pears and bananas).
150 calories per 1/4 cup chocolate sauce with fruit.
